'Gideon' at 50 and the right to counsel: Their words

Mon, 03/18/2013 - 03:06
Monday marks the 50th anniversary of the Supreme Court's landmark ruling in Gideon v Wainwright in which the justices unanimously affirmed a constitutional right to a lawyer for criminal defendants too poor to afford one.

Shipyard worker sentenced to 17 years for $400 million submarine fire

Sat, 03/16/2013 - 06:31
A shipyard worker who pleaded guilty to arson in a fire that did at least $400 million in damage to a U.S. nuclear attack submarine has been sentenced to over 17 years in federal prison and ordered to pay $400 million in restitution, federal prosecutors said Friday.

Judge removed from White Bulger trial

Thu, 03/14/2013 - 07:27
The federal judge presiding over the case of reputed former Boston mob boss James "Whitey" Bulger has been removed by the First Circuit Court of Appeals in Boston, after the defense raised concerns about his capacity for impartiality.
